Latest Patents

One of Bossack's notable recent inventions is the "Piggyback Recorder for Adding Second Recorder to a Printer Terminal." This innovative device allows for the addition of a second recorder to a printer terminal already equipped with a first recorder for printing initial data. By being detachably mounted on the first recorder, the piggyback recorder facilitates the printing of a second set of data, enhancing the terminal's functionality. It comprises a piggyback print member capable of printing the additional data, a mounting member for attachment to the first print member, and a solenoid to control movement during the printing process.

Another remarkable invention by Bossack is the "Unidirectional Ribbon Drive Mechanism." This unique mechanism allows the ribbon to be driven past the printing station of a printer only when the print head moves in a specific direction. It utilizes an endless timing belt to rotate a gear pulley, which interacts with an idler gear that is designed to respond to the direction of rotation efficiently.
